Output 650c21c988132b9f3395f1284fd3ef34885e90021a1bfbab3a515b4e5b045f68:7

value
577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 519464fb6fe35db609ab0ecc1e45d5bfe647588a OP_EQUAL
address
398NRi8b8235FzF9U3pDUyfnvLqh9hEbe2
transaction
650c21c988132b9f3395f1284fd3ef34885e90021a1bfbab3a515b4e5b045f68
spent
true